About the Role

We have an exciting opportunity to join ourInformation Compliance Teamas an Information Compliance Administrative Officer. This full-time administrative role is central to supporting our team across a range of Records Management and Data Protection disciplines.

As a key member of the team you will work in a fastpaced environment producing high-quality documents with precision and accuracy often to tight deadlines. You will also be responsible for using and maintaining our in-house case management system to ensure that information is recorded correctly and efficiently.

This is a fantastic role for a confident organised professional who takes pride in delivering excellent service and enjoys being part of a collaborative and supportive team.

Key Responsibilities of the post holder

Prepare correspondence court documents reports and presentations to a high professional standard

Organise maintain and develop our electronic case management systems ensuring accuracy and attention to detail

Use Microsoft applications (such as Outlook Word Excel and Teams) confidently to support daily tasks

Support team members with a variety of administrative tasks

About You

The ideal candidate will:

  • Be skilled in producing professional documents correspondence and maintaining accurate records;
  • Be highly proficient in the use of Microsoft Office applications (Outlook Word Excel and Teams);
  • Can demonstrate excellent communication skills with customers and colleagues;
  • Ability to deal with sensitive and confidential information;
  • Can work effectively as part of a team and proactively using own initiative;
